52 Pa. Code § 1.51. Instructions for service, notice and protest.

§ 1.51. Instructions for service, notice and protest.

 (a)  General rule. Upon receiving an application, the Secretary will instruct the applicant or petitioner concerning the required service and public notice consistent with this section.

 (b)  Service list for parties. The Commission will make available to filing users on the electronic filing system a service list for each docket in which they are a party that contains the following provisions:

   (1)  The names and addresses of the parties.

   (2)  An indication of whether or not a party has agreed to receive electronic service.

   (3)  The e-mail addresses of parties who have agreed to receive electronic service.
